Need ideas on beautifying a plastic & steel vegie garden
OK, technically an aquaponic system. As pictured below:
I need ideas on beautifying the whole thing so that it doesn't look agricultural and fit in with a modern house. It will be located right next to the alfresco entertaining area.
Some of the dimentions of this are;
Stand: 2.2m long x 1.2m wide
Round Tank: 1.7m diameter
What I had in mind is to clad it all round with something like bamboo screening or wood decking. Bearing in mind that the tank will hold edible fish, and the grow bed is for edible vegies - so nothing that will contaminate the system.
Now, for many questions:
1. Is there something more durable than bamboo screening?
2. Is there something cheaper than timber decking as I don't need it so strong
3. I really need ideas on how to stick blocks of wood (so that I can screw/fix the cladding over) to the side of the plastic tanks. Would Liquid Nails be suitable?
Any other ideas or suggestions are appreciated.

could you just build a frame around it and not connected directly to it and affix whatever cladding (bamboo screening?) to that? Though probably steer clear of treated pine even if it doesn't come in direct contact with the water....
